The fog cannon machine operates ingeniously. A high – pressure pump pressurizes water, which is then atomized into minuscule water mist particles via a special nozzle. A powerful fan propels these particles into the air, where they meet and adhere to dust particles. The combined weight causes the dust to settle, effectively reducing particulate matter in the air, whether at construction sites or mines.
Compared to traditional sprinkling, the fog cannon machine has a much wider spraying range, reaching tens or even hundreds of meters. In large construction sites, it can quickly reduce PM10 and PM2.5 levels. For instance, in a vast construction area, PM10 dropped from over 800 micrograms per cubic meter to under 200 after using the fog cannon machine, greatly improving the surrounding environment.
With water resources scarce, the fog cannon machine’s water – saving feature is significant. It atomizes water into fine particles, using only a fraction of the water a traditional sprinkler truck would for the same dust suppression effect. In a medium – sized industrial plant, a sprinkler truck might use dozens of tons of water daily, while a fog cannon machine needs only a few. Additionally, its energy – saving motor and optimized hydraulic system ensure low power consumption.
It offers multiple installation and mobility options. It can be fixed for long – term local use or mounted on a vehicle for on – the – go applications. In both urban streets and remote mines, it can reach the operation site easily. Operation is simple; an operator can adjust spraying angles, flow, and wind force via a remote or control panel according to dust conditions.
Beyond dust suppression, in summer, it cools and humidifies public areas. In agriculture, it aids pest control by evenly spraying atomized pesticides. In chemical plants and waste treatment facilities, it deodorizes by spraying atomized deodorants, enhancing air quality across various sectors.
Construction sites are major dust sources. Multiple fog cannon machines, placed at key spots like excavation areas and material yards, can continuously spray water mist, settling construction – generated dust. This not only creates a cleaner work environment but also boosts the construction company’s green image, aligning with sustainable development goals.
Mining activities produce copious dust, endangering workers’ health and harming the environment. Fog cannon machines are widely used in mines, on mining sites, in crushing workshops, and along transport roads. They suppress dust, improving air quality around mines and protecting nearby vegetation and water sources for sustainable mining.
Vehicle exhaust and road dust pollute urban air. Fog cannon vehicles, shuttling through city streets daily, spray water mist to reduce particulate matter and adsorb harmful exhaust pollutants. This freshens the air and provides cooling and humidification in summer, enhancing residents’ quality of life.
Industrial plants such as cement and steel plants generate a lot of dust and waste gas. Fog cannon machines function in production workshops and material yards, reducing dust spillage and pollution. Their use enables enterprises to achieve clean production, meet environmental standards, and enhance their competitiveness.
